Visiting visa

Hello everyone, I need advice. I want to invite my mother to the UK. My daughter, who is on my dependant visa, has already had her visa approved. Is it possible for my mother to travel with her if her visitor visa is approved? When I was filling out her application, there was a question asking whether she is travelling alone, and I was not sure whether to answer “yes” or “no.” Also, should I mention in the invitation letter that she will be travelling with my 4-year-old child. Regarding the Visa Application

We are unable to make a decision on your application within published visa processing times. Do not contact UK Visa and Immigration, we will contact you if we require more information.

Please be assured that we will continue to progress your application to make a decision as soon as possible.

Your visa application may take longer to process, if for example:

• the information in your application is not accurate or requires further consideration

• you need to provide further evidence, for example evidence of funds

• your supporting documents need to be verified

• you need to attend an interview

• further information is required on your personal circumstances (for example if you have a criminal conviction)

• UKVI is experiencing increased visa demand
